Step-by-Step Guide to Making Bone Broth in the house
Producing bone broth at home can be a fulfilling cooking endeavor that boosts both flavor and nutrition in various dishes. To begin, one must select top quality bones, ideally from organic or grass-fed sources. Roasting the bones at 400 ° F for regarding half an hour can heighten the flavor. Next off, transfer the roasted bones to a big pot or slow stove and cover them with cold water. Adding a splash of vinegar aids essence minerals from the bones.Include fragrant veggies like onions, carrots, and celery for added depth, in addition to herbs and spices as preferred. Bring the blend to a boil, then decrease to a simmer. It is essential to allow the broth simmer for a minimum of 12 hours, however longer is more effective for maximum richness. Stress the broth through a fine-mesh sieve and store it in airtight containers, all set to raise meals with its healthy essence.
Tips for Perfecting Your Bone Brew Simmer
While simmering bone brew, maintaining the right temperature level and timing is necessary for achieving a rich and savory outcome. A mild simmer, ideally between 190 ° F and 210 ° F, helps extract maximum nutrients and flavors without steaming, which can make the broth cloudy. It is advisable to keep an eye on the pot closely, adjusting the heat as needed to preserve this simmer.Timing is also vital; a longer simmer, generally ranging from 12 to 2 days, enables for deeper flavor removal and collagen release. For hen bones, a 12 to 24-hour simmer suffices, while beef bones gain from longer cooking times.Additionally, skimming off any foam or contaminations that climb to the surface area during the initial couple of hours can boost the brew's clarity and taste. Ultimately, making certain the pot is covered during simmering helps to maintain moisture and escalate the flavors, producing an extra gratifying final product.

Freezing Strategies Described
Freezing techniques are necessary for successfully storing and protecting homemade bone broth, guaranteeing its abundant tastes and nutrients remain intact for future usage. To ice up bone broth, it is advisable to allow it great totally prior to transferring it to storage containers. Glass containers, silicone molds, or durable freezer bags appropriate alternatives. When utilizing jars, leave area at the top for expansion throughout freezing. Portioning the broth right into smaller quantities permits easy thawing and reduces waste. Tag containers with the date and materials for easy recognition. For peak top quality, consume the icy broth within 3 to six months - Bone Broth Delivery. Thawing can be carried out in the fridge or by utilizing a microwave, ensuring that the broth is heated thoroughly prior to intake
Refrigeration Best Practices
While many concentrate on freezing as a method of preservation, refrigeration also plays a vital function in saving homemade bone brew successfully. When cooled down, bone broth ought to be transferred to closed containers, ensuring very little air exposure to stop spoilage. It is advisable to refrigerate brew within two hours of food preparation to preserve its quality. Typically, homemade bone broth can be stored in the fridge for up to five days. Labeling containers with dates can aid track freshness. For peak flavor and safety, broth needs to be reheated to a moving boil prior to intake. If longer storage is required, cold stays an excellent option, but proper refrigeration practices guarantee that bone broth continues to be nourishing and tasty for short-term usage.
